The weapons selector can be enabled by pressing either the "Switch primary weapons" or "Switch secondary weapons" key; and can be deactivated by pressing the "Exit selected weapon mode" key. The SACLOS guidance system improves on MCLOS by having a device that calculates correction commands such that the gunner only has to point the sight of the targeting device at the target, and the appropriate correction commands will be performed by the device. Without the weapons selector the player must fire all their Sidewinders before they can fire their Skyflashes, however the bombs and rockets may be dropped at any time using their separate control. Flares are infrared countermeasures fired off by aircraft to counter infrared homing (heat-seeking) missiles. A flare is considered a decoy, depending on the material it is made from to either burn as hot or hotter than the aircraft's exhaust in an attempt to cause the missile to target it. Infrared homing missiles are similar in use to TV guided missiles, but feature an infrared imaging system instead of the optical camera, allowing heat sources (such as tanks) to be more easily differentiated and locked onto in cluttered environments and under low optical visibility conditions such as night-time.
